- [ ] **Archive cold storage buckets (Glacierpoint tier).** Verify last-write timestamps exceed 180 days, snapshot bucket manifests, then seal each archive with the ceremony key. Two operators from the Vaultine team must co-sign. Once sealed, buckets are immutable until the next ceremony. Unsealing for audit requires the ceremony recovery passphrase, recorded on the line below.

vault phrase of tajeg-tageg = pelix-druix-holius-briael-zorwyn-frawyn-fraox-norok-drueth-aldiel

Handover: dependency pinning (Team Oakmere)

Quick note before I switch teams — we pin everything in the Larchbolt manifest, no floating versions, ever. Upgrades go through the weekly review, not ad hoc bumps. New folks: read the pinning policy page first. Questions about exceptions should go to the policy owner named below.

named custodian: Brivan Eliath Quenox Frador

Runbook: Hookshot webhook delivery, v3.2 rollout. Retries now use jittered exponential backoff, capped at six attempts; after that, events park in the dead-letter topic. Security note: every retry re-signs the payload, so receivers should tolerate duplicate signatures but never skipped ones. Flip the `retry_v2` flag only after canary looks clean. The canary signer needs to be provisioned with the deploy key below.

rollout seal: bky4_yke3

## Runbook: Orphan Sweeper

The orphan sweeper runs hourly and deletes volumes, snapshots, and load balancer targets in the Dornfield cluster that have no owning deployment for more than 24 hours. If the sweeper alerts on a backlog over 200 items, check whether the tagging service is down before assuming a genuine leak. To run a dry-run sweep manually, call the Reaperd control endpoint with the `--plan` flag. The endpoint requires authentication to our internal inventory API using the key below.

service key, fawip-bajef: kto11_Qt5wZK9vdNC